Local & County Affairs Committee

The Local & County Affairs Committee provides a forum to facilitate communication and cooperation between the business community and local and county government on issues of mutual interest.  The Committee meets on the second Friday of each month and is hosted by a different mayor.  Attending members of these meetings give County and Town reports.  If you’re interested in what’s going on in Union County or want to establish a relationship with a municipality, these meetings are for you.  For more information, please call Helen Durish at 908-352-0900.

The Platform for Progress is a coalition of New Jersey businesses and organizations working in partnership with the New Jersey Chamber of Commerce. The coalition is dedicated to bringing solutions to long-term challenges our state is facing in six key areas, Economic Development, Education, Environment, Government Reform, Health Care and Transportation.  Follow the above link to find out more.
